Being a technically advanced 770-seat theatre with retractable seating, the Great Hall is also home to London’s second largest stage. It has been a staple venue in the activities of the University, ...
An occasional feature, in which we mourn the loss of an exceptional slice of London, wishing it was still here. This time: the Great Hall in the old Euston station.